The DiaoYu Islands are situated in the northeast parts ofTaiwan province near the East Sea, where it is only6.5squarekilometers.The DiaoYu Islands are composed of several small islands,including Diaoyu Island, Wangwei Yu, Chiwei Yu and some very smallrocks. The Chinese government always claims that the DiaoYu Islands areone part of its inherent territory. Based on the historical documents andbooks we have now, we could conclude that it is Chinese people to firstlydiscover these islands, thus named and made use of these islands. Theearliest historical documents that recorded the DiaoYu Islands were《SHUN FENG XIANG SONG》during the Ming Dynasty,aftermaththere were so many other historical documents and related books fromChina and Japan and western world that recorded the DiaoYu Islandsproved that the sovereignty of the DiaoYu Islands belong to China. In theyear of1895, Japanese government officially classified these islands as onepart of its land during the cabinet conference and gradually took control ofthe whole island by its military force illegally. The Chinese governmentalways claims its territory rights over the DiaoYu Islands and stresses thatDiaoYu Islands belong to China. The actions that Japanese government hastaken will not bring about any legitimate force in terms of international law. The “1969report” predicated that the area of East Sea may potentiallyhave great amounts of oil and natural gas resource which both have specialmeanings to China and Japan, together with its unique position, it would beseen as very strategically important to both countries in terms of themilitary.Today both China and Japan have different point views towardsthe issue of DiaoYu Islands. The purpose of this paper is mainly to lookback to the source of the issue of Diaoyu Islands and try to analyses thenature of the issue from different perspectives; hopefully it would give thereferences for further confirming the fact that DiaoYu Islands belong toChina.
